The National EDSA Organization has found that participating EDSA members in grades 5 to 12 are challenged to develop critical thinking and effective decision-making skills, foster teamwork, and promote communication while recognizing the value of ethical competition and individual achievement through our Leadership and Career Development Events. Our events occur at the local, state, and national levels.
Our Development Events portal is the place to find information about our various career development and leardership conference and work shop events.
EDSA members have the opportunity to participate in Career Development Events at the local, state, and national level each year. These events are designed to allow students to put what they learn in the classroom to use in a hands-on environment that serves as an extention of the classroom. Events range from job interview and public speaking events to mechanics and science related events.
